What artificial intelligence techniques power effective vibe coding algorithms?

Effective **vibe coding**, which is the practice of instilling a website with a specific emotional tone or "vibe," leverages a sophisticated mix of artificial intelligence techniques.

## Key AI Techniques for Vibe Coding

Several AI methodologies work in concert to achieve compelling vibe-coded designs:

### Natural Language Processing (NLP)

**Natural Language Processing (NLP)** is fundamental. It analyzes various textual inputs to discern desired sentiment and tone.

* **Sentiment analysis:** This technique gauges the emotional resonance of text. By understanding the emotional leanings of content and feedback, the AI can align design elements to evoke appropriate feelings.
* **Keyword extraction:** Identifies core themes and concepts. This helps in understanding the subject matter and guiding the visual and interactive design choices that support the message.

The role of NLP ensures that the website's textual content harmonizes with its visual and interactive elements to create a unified user experience. ### Machine Learning (ML)

**Machine Learning (ML)** algorithms are critical, especially deep learning models, which are trained on extensive datasets. These datasets include successful website designs, user engagement metrics, and aesthetic preferences.

* **Convolutional Neural Networks (CNNs):** Primarily used for **image analysis**. A CNN can learn to associate specific visual cues—like color palettes, typography, and image styles—with particular vibes such as 'calm' or 'energetic.'
* **Recurrent Neural Networks (RNNs):** Employed for **sequential data**, such as user interaction flows. RNNs can understand patterns in how users navigate and engage with a site, helping to refine the experience.

### Generative Adversarial Networks (GANs)

**Generative Adversarial Networks (GANs)** are increasingly being explored for their ability to create novel design elements.

* GANs can generate unique layouts, graphical assets, or even entire page compositions that perfectly align with a specified vibe. This pushes the boundaries of automated design, offering fresh and original visual solutions.

### Reinforcement Learning (RL)

**Reinforcement Learning (RL)** offers a dynamic approach to design refinement.

* RL can iteratively refine design choices based on real-time feedback, such as user interactions and A/B test results. This allows the AI to "learn" and optimize which elements most effectively contribute to the desired website vibe over time, enhancing user engagement and overall effectiveness.

The synergy of these AI techniques enables vibe coding to move beyond static templates, creating truly dynamic and emotionally resonant digital experiences.
